No aid convoys would cross into Gaza from Egypt today due to the loss of telecom networks in the Palestinian enclave, a UN official has said. A lack of fuel to create electricity has shut down internet and phone networks for the past two days, effectively cutting off the besieged territory from the outside world and making aid missions more perilous.
